The footy world has been rocked following the death of a South Australian Football League premiership winner.

Nick Lowden, 23, died on Thursday, the Norwood Football Club confirmed in a statement.  

‘The Norwood Football Club is deeply saddened to announce the passing of premiership player and current squad member, Nicholas Lowden,’ the club said on Friday.

‘Nick played 22 League games across two seasons with the club in 2022 and 2023. He had previously played for the Casey Demons in Victoria.

‘The club is devastated by his passing, and is thinking of his family, the playing group, coaches, and the wider Norwood Football Club community at this difficult time.

‘A powerful, strong player around the contest, Nick immediately made an impact on the field ensuring that his presence was felt particularly by opposition players.

‘He made his League debut at Norwood Oval in Round 8, 2022.

‘Lowds’ played a variety of key roles but few more impactful and memorable than his role in the victorious 2022 SANFL grand final.

‘Nick performed solidly at the beginning of this year before a calf injury in Round 9 interrupted his season.

‘Nick will be remembered by all of his teammates along with the coaches, volunteers, support and administration staff of the Norwood Football Club. We all send our heartfelt condolences to his family and loved ones.’

Lowden, a former VFL star, was recruited to Norwood from Casey, having come through at Gippsland Power. He also played footy for the Darwin Buffaloes in the NTFL.

Following the devastating news, SANFL also released a statement.

‘The South Australian Football Commission and everyone at SANFL are incredibly saddened by the tragic and unexpected death of Norwood Football Club player Nicholas Lowden,’ the statement reads.

‘The midfielder’s valuable contribution to Norwood Football Club and the SANFL men’s league in his short time playing in South Australia will always be remembered.

‘We send our heartfelt condolences and offer comfort and support to Nick’s family and friends, the players, coaches and staff of the Norwood Football Club and the extended football community at this difficult time.’
